Custom Watercolor Portrait
Look up small-batch watercolor artists on Etsy or Instagram. Send them three good photos of the cat, and you'll get a hand-painted portrait back in 1 to 3 weeks. Expect to spend $40 to $120 depending on size and detail.
This is the gift that ends up framed above the couch for the next 15 years. Worth it.
Engraved Photo Locket or Pendant
A small pendant with their cat's photo inside, often with the cat's name engraved on the back. Quietly emotional. Especially powerful for someone who has lost a cat or has a senior cat they're savoring time with.
Personalized Embroidered Cat-Photo Pillow
Send a photo of the cat, get back a pillow that looks like the cat. Etsy is full of small embroidery shops doing this work for $50 to $90. It's tactile, it's soft, and the cat will absolutely sit on it.

A Cat Behaviorist Consultation
If their cat has a quirk they'd love to understand, territorial spraying, mystery 3 a.m. yowling, an apparent grudge against the mailman, gift them an hour with a certified cat behaviorist. Often $75 to $150 per session. According to the American Veterinary Medical Association, behavior consultations can resolve issues that would otherwise lead to surrender, making this a gift that helps the cat and the human.

A Donation to a Cat Rescue or TNR Program in Their Name
For the cat lover with too much stuff already, this one hits different. Donate to a cat rescue, a senior cat sanctuary, or a community cat / TNR program (trap-neuter-return) in their name. They get a card. A cat in need gets a real chance.

A Recording of Their Cat Purring, Turned Into Visual Art
Some artists take audio waveforms and turn them into framed prints. Record their cat purring on a phone, send the file, and you'll get back a beautiful waveform print on paper or wood. About $40 to $80. It's the kind of gift you absolutely cannot buy anywhere else.

A Photo Book Pulled From Their Phone
Sneakily ask their partner or best friend for access to their camera roll. Pull 50 to 80 of the best cat photos. Print a hardcover photo book. Hand them a flipbook of every soft, ridiculous, perfect moment with their cat.
A Hand-Poured Candle Inspired by Their Cat
Some indie candlemakers offer "cat-inspired" scents, kitten paws, library cat, sunbeam nap, that specific blanket. Niche, weird, deeply loved.
Adopt-a-Cat in Their Name
Many shelters offer symbolic adoptions: you sponsor a specific shelter cat for a year, and your gift recipient gets updates and photos. It's a relationship. Less like a gift, more like an invitation into a small ongoing story.

How to Pick the Right Cat Gift for the Cat Lover in Your Life
Stuck? Run through these five questions before you buy.
- How long have they had the cat? Newer cat moms and cat dads love personalization. Long-time cat parents already have everything, go experiential or charitable.
- Are they a "the cat is family" person or a "the cat is decor" person? Family-energy people want emotional gifts. Decor-energy people want beautiful objects.
- Do they post their cat on social media? If yes, gifts that photograph well (custom video, framed art) get bonus points.
- Is there a specific quirk that defines their cat? That quirk is gift gold. Lean in.
- Did they recently lose a cat or have a senior cat? Tread softly. A custom memorial song or a sponsored shelter cat hits hardest here.
